Capacity note for the Fennelgrid sidecar review. Aggregation window widened to cut emit rate; per-pod memory ceiling holds at current cardinality (~12k series). CPU flat. Risk: buffer overflow if a tenant spikes labels — mitigated by the drop policy. No node-pool changes needed for the Caldermoor cluster this quarter. Review the flush and buffer settings before merge. Constants under review are below.

limits module of yafop-hahag:
QUOTAS = {
    "tamwyn": 652,
    "prawyn": 731,
}

Subject: Whisperhall cut-over — done (mostly)

Hi on-call folks,

The museum audio-guide app is now fully on the new Whisperhall backend as of last night. Tours stream from the new media cluster, and the old server is read-only until Friday, then gone. Known wrinkle: a few offline-downloaded tours still point at legacy URLs; the redirect layer catches them, so don't panic at the 301 spike. If anything melts, roll back via the toggle, not a redeploy. The live settings after cut-over are below.

deployment values, yadug-bawif:
[framir]
team = pelox
access_code = ac_a38ab2
owner = tamion.julael
host = framir.tolvaqlabs.test
port = 11211
peer = tammir.zemvargrid.local
salt = 2215ef03
pin = 1541

**Plugin overlays not appearing on the seat map**

If your plugin's overlay layer fails to draw on the Prosceniate renderer, verify you are targeting layout schema v4 or later; earlier schemas lack the overlay anchor points. Also confirm your plugin declares the `overlay.draw` capability in its manifest. To validate your manifest against the Grandstage sandbox, call the validation endpoint authenticated with the token below.

session JWT of yawep-yawep = eyJhbGciOiJIUzI1NiIsInR5cCI6IkpXVCJ9.eyJzdWIiOiI3pWF3_In0.aXYsHiog

Runbook: Ledgerbarn monthly partitioning cutover.

Scope: split `events` table into monthly partitions starting next release. Steps: freeze writes for five minutes, run the Marrowfield migration script, verify row counts per partition, unfreeze. Rollback: reattach the legacy table, drop new partitions. Owner for this week: the Harrowgate data squad. Migration bundle must be signed before the scheduler will accept it. For this cutover, sign with the key below.

release key, kagaf-tahop: bky6_tFmur5